            "title": "Apollo 17 Landing Site",
            "description": "Apollo 17, crewed by Eugene Cernan, Ronald Evans, and Harrison Schmitt, was the final Apollo mission to the Moon. The Lunar Module Challenger landed in the Taurus-Littrow valley on December 11, 1972 and remained there for 75 hours. The landing site is a relatively flat spot among low mountains at the southeastern edge of Mare Serenitatis.The images here are designed for display on NASA's hyperwall. They help tell the story of Apollo 17's exploration of the Taurus-Littrow site using data and imaging from Lunar Reconnaissance Orbiter (LRO) and photographs taken by the astronauts. LRO's detailed and comprehensive remote sensing capabilities have fostered a reinterpretation of the geology of the site. || ",

            "title": "Ten Cool Things Seen in the First Year of LRO",
            "description": "Having officially reached lunar orbit on June 23nd, 2009, the Lunar Reconnaissance Orbiter (LRO) has now marked one full year on its mission to scout the moon. Maps and datasets collected by LRO's state-of-the-art instruments will form the foundation for all future lunar exploration plans, as well as be critical to scientists working to better understand the moon and its environment. In only the first year of the mission, LRO has gathered more digital information than any previous planetary mission in history. To celebrate one year in orbit, here are ten cool things already observed by LRO. Note that the stories here are just a small sample of what the LRO team has released and barely touch on the major scientific accomplishments of the mission.
